Linksys VELOP Status LED Meaning
Every device you receive for networking use will come with a
status LED and that status LED actually cam tell you so many things about the
device. Linksys VELOP LED meanings are explained in this blog and you
can easily make sure that your Linksys VELOP device is working well for your
home network.
Status LED for the Linksys VELOP can tell you about the
current status for the device and the meaning for the status LED are given
below.
If the status LED for Linksys VELOP is blinking in solid
yellow color that means you must place second node of Linksys VELOP near to
first node.
If the status LED for Linksys VELOP is blinking in solid red
color that means your Linksys VELOP is not having a valid internet connection
If the status LED for Linksys VELOP is blinking in red color
that means your Linksys VELOP is slowing losing the internet connections.
If the status LED for Linksys VELOP is blinking in solid
purple color that means your Linksys VELOP device is all ready for the setup
and configurations.
